The ACL season has commenced with little fanfare or media coverage, highlighting a broader trend of MLB neglecting minor leagues. In a recent game, the ACL Brewers defeated the ACL White Sox 7-6 in a seven-inning contest. The lack of promotion and visibility for rookie leagues is concerning, especially as talented players, such as Adrian Gil, emerge from these teams. Gil showed impressive performance in this game, nearly accomplishing a rare cycle despite time constraints and unclear rules that seem to be changing regularly.
The ACL season seemed to sneak up on everybody, given that as of this writing there hasn't been a single word published about the season out there.
For a sport that has shrunk its minor leagues ostensibly to save money, MLB sure does sweep its Stateside rookie league into a corner.
It was a surprise to me when I clicked today's White Sox minor league boxes and saw the ACL in action!
Adrian Gil was a bad, bad, bad man in the DSL in 2023 and took it on the chin his first year Stateside, last summer.
